Recognizing the RLE Treatment



Refractive lens exchange (RLE) includes a series of specific steps developed to boost your vision.

First, your optometrist will certainly perform a detailed assessment to evaluate your eye health and wellness and establish if you're an ideal candidate.

As soon as authorized, you'll obtain an anesthetic to ensure comfort during the procedure.

Your doctor will make a tiny incision in your cornea, allowing accessibility to the over cast lens. They'll very carefully remove it and replace it with a personalized synthetic lens customized to your particular vision needs.

The procedure commonly takes concerning 15-30 mins, and you'll be awake throughout.

Later, you'll receive post-operative directions to help ensure a smooth healing, permitting you to appreciate your improved vision quickly.

Advantages and Threats of RLE



After recognizing the RLE treatment, it is very important to evaluate the benefits and dangers connected with it.



One major advantage is the capacity for enhanced vision, enabling you to decrease or get rid of the demand for glasses or contact lenses. Many patients experience improved quality of life and greater liberty in day-to-day activities.

Nonetheless, like any surgical procedure, RLE lugs dangers. Problems can consist of infection, retinal detachment, or vision adjustments that may not be correctable. There's also the opportunity of requiring extra procedures.

It's important to have a detailed discussion with your eye treatment expert about your particular circumstance. By evaluating these variables carefully, you can make an enlightened decision regarding whether RLE is the right option for you.
